Ducati Scrambler 800 Café Racer (2019)

The Ducati Scrambler 800 Café Racer motorcycle is a 2019 model with a four-stroke, L twin-cylinder engine and a capacity of 803 cc. It has electronic fuel injection, a 6-speed transmission, and chain final drive. The frame is made of tubular steel, and it has Kayaba front and rear suspension with 150 mm of travel. The front brakes are a single 330 mm disc with a radial 4-piston calliper and Bosch Cornering ABS as standard. The rear brakes are a single 245 mm disc with a 1-piston floating calliper and Bosch Cornering ABS as standard. The wheels are 10-spoke light alloy, and the tires are Pirelli MT 60 RS. The bike has a low seat height of 860 mm, but an accessory seat is available at 840 mm. The dry weight is 193 kg, and the fuel capacity is 13.5 litres. The standard equipment includes a steel tank with interchangeable aluminium side panels, LED lighting, LCD dashboard, and under-seat storage with a USB socket. Additional equipment can be added such as an aluminum handlebar, front stem protectors, and other modifications to the design.
